Gross yield is weekly rent × 52 ÷ price. Net yield subtracts operating expenses. Cashflow then subtracts interest-only interest on price × LVR. Tax, vacancies, and principal repayments are not included.

Listed by Luxury Real Estate Agents TruganinaWelcome to 24 Banjo Boulevard, Fraser Rise,
Luxury, quality and lifestyle come together in this beautifully crafted family residence, positioned in the highly sought-after Westwood Estate. Set on approximately 383sqm, this exceptional brick home has been thoughtfully designed with premium finishes, generous proportions and a practical floorplan, delivering the perfect balance of sophistication and everyday comfort. Featuring four spacious bedrooms, three beautifully appointed bathrooms, multiple living zones and a double garage, this is a home that has been built to impress from every angle.
A Home Designed for Modern Family Living,
Step inside to discover soaring high ceilings and a welcoming formal lounge that creates an elegant first impression. As you move through the home, you'll find a light-filled open-plan living and dining area, perfectly complemented by a highly upgraded designer kitchen featuring quality finishes, ample storage and generous preparation space-ideal for both everyday living and entertaining.
This Home has been thoughtfully designed to suit growing families, while the luxurious bathrooms, complete with floor-to-ceiling tiles, add a refined touch of elegance throughout. Outside, the fully concreted backyard provides a stylish, low-maintenance space that's perfect for entertaining family and friends all year round.
